虚拟线圈数对车流量统计模型影响的定量分析 被引量:1

摘要 在定量分析虚拟线圈数目对车流量统计准确率影响因素基础上,采用简化的高斯混合模型进行背景提取,使用背景差法提取出前景信息,经过图像后处理进行车流量统计。最后,基于OpenCV采用C++语言编程实现了求解分析。 This paper aims at quantitative analysis of the influence of the number of virtual loops on the statistical accuracy for vehicle flow. Meanwhile, this paper uses simplified Gaussian mixture model for background extraction, and then uses the background subtraction method to extract the foreground information. After the image post-processing, the vehicle flow is to be calculated. Finally, OpenCV-based C++ language is used to program for solving and analysis algorithm.
